Early Life and the Rise to Fame
Born in Maud, Oklahoma, in October 1937, Wanda Jackson’s musical journey began at a young age. Her family’s move to California exposed her to a vibrant music scene that would shape her unique style. She started her career in the 1950s, initially singing country music. However, her association with Elvis Presley, who encouraged her to explore rockabilly, proved to be a pivotal moment. Jackson embraced this fusion, becoming one of the first and most prominent female rockabilly singers. Her performances were known for their energy and rebellious spirit, captivating audiences and challenging gender norms in the music industry.
Musical Achievements and Hit Singles
Wanda Jackson’s discography boasts an impressive collection of 45 studio albums, showcasing her versatility and adaptability. Her early albums, released on Capitol Records, are considered classics. She achieved significant commercial success with several hit singles. Some of her most notable hits include:
- “You Can’t Have My Love”
- “Right or Wrong”
- “In the Middle of a Heartache”
- “Santo Domingo”
- “Tears Will Be the Chaser for Your Wine”
- “A Woman Lives for Love”
- “Fancy Satin Pillows”
These songs solidified her position in the music industry and earned her a dedicated fanbase. Her ability to blend country, rockabilly, and rock and roll elements set her apart from her contemporaries and contributed to her enduring appeal. Her music continues to be enjoyed by fans across generations, and she’s still regarded as a musical pioneer.

Awards and Recognitions
Wanda Jackson’s contributions to music have been widely recognized and celebrated:
- Rock and Roll Hall of Fame: Inducted in 2009 as an Early Influence, cementing her place in music history.
- Rockabilly Hall of Fame: Acknowledgment of her crucial role in the development of rockabilly music.
- Americana Lifetime Achievement Award: Recognition of her significant contributions to American music.
These accolades are testaments to her enduring impact on the music industry and her place among the most influential figures of her generation.
